DAB Radio

Selecting a preset DAB station

Press PRESET +/- ( or 3 / 4 on the remote control ) to select desired preset station.

2Press OK to confirm the selection.

Note

– If you have not yet stored a DAB station in one of the presets, "Empty preset" will be displayed.The display will revert to the previously selected station after a few seconds.

Resetting to the factory setting

Resetting to the factory setting will delete all of the preset stations.

1In standby mode, on the mani unit, press and hold MENU and PRESET + simultaneously.

2Then press press 9 to reset.

Changing the DAB station information

On the display of DAB broadcasting, the first line shows a station name, and the second line shows the service information for the current station. 7 types of service information are available.

Press INFO./RDS repeatedly to cycle through the display information.

Using the MENU control

The menu control lets you access the DAB radio setup options.

1In DAB mode, press MENU to enter the menu options.

The first setup option "Manual tune" is displayed.

2Press 4 / ¢to scroll the menu options:

Manual tune -> Auto scan local -> Auto scan full -> DRC value -> Sw version

3To select an option, press OK.

4Repeat steps 2-3if sub-option is available under one option.

Manual tune

By using this feature, it is possible to manually tune to a specific channel/frequency. In addition to antenna orienting for better radio reception, the optimal reception can also be obtained by using this feature.

1In DAB mode, press MENU to display "Manual tune" option.

2Press OK to confirm the selection.

Display shows a channel and its frequency.

3Press 4 / ¢ repeatedly until desired channel/frequency appears.

4Press OK to confirm the selection.

You may press INFO./RDS to change the service information on the display.

You may adjust the position of the antenna to obtain the optimal signal strength.

Local scan and Full scan

Local scan is used to perform a small range of DAB radio search (in UK). Full scan is used to perform a wide range of DAB radio search (outside UK).

1In DAB mode, press MENU to enter the menu options.

2Press 4 / ¢ repeatedly until “Auto scan local” or “Auto scan full“ is displayed.

3Press OK to confirm the selection. The loca or full scan will auto start.
